'Hearts of Iron 2: Doomsday' Goes Gold

by Rainier on March 31, 2006 @ 6:02 a.m. PST

Paradox Interactive announced today that the latest addition to their award-winning strategy portfolio, Hearts of Iron 2: Doomsday, has gone gold.

"Hearts of Iron 2: Doomsday is our answer to the call from a demanding Hearts of Iron 2 audience" says Fredrik W. Lindgren, Director of Publishing at Paradox Interactive. "Not only does this game include cool new features, scenarios and a great scenario editor; we have also included quality content to the box that makes the USD/EUR 19.99 price point a no-brainer to all strategy gamers."

Hearts of Iron 2: Doomsday will be available worldwide starting next week. The international shipping dates are April 4 for North America and April 7 for most other markets.

Hearts of Iron 2: Doomsday features:

  • World War II scenario with an alternative historical outcome.
  • Extended time line until 1953 with historical scenarios including the Israeli conflict.
  • Complete scenario editor.
  • Expanded tech trees allowing players to develop tactical nukes and other types of nuclear warfare as well as helicopter squads, escort carriers etc.
  • Enhanced Brigade Attachment system increases the player~Rs tactical opportunities.
  • Significantly improved AI.
  • Tradable Weapons - equip your allies with the latest technological advances or get other nations to surrender their secrets.
